| // S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0 |
| /* |
| * A test of splitting PMD THPs and PTE-mapped THPs from a specified virtual |
| * address range in a process via <debugfs>/split_huge_pages interface. |
| */ |

| /* |
| * gather_after_split_folio_orders - scan through [vaddr_start, len) and record |
| * folio orders |
| * |
| * @vaddr_start: start vaddr |
| * @len: range length |
| * @pagemap_fd: file descriptor to /proc/<pid>/pagemap |
| * @kpageflags_fd: file descriptor to /proc/kpageflags |
| * @orders: output folio order array |
| * @nr_orders: folio order array size |
| * |
| * gather_after_split_folio_orders() scan through [vaddr_start, len) and check |
| * all folios within the range and record their orders. All order-0 pages will |
| * be recorded. Non-present vaddr is skipped. |
| * |
| * NOTE: the function is used to check folio orders after a split is performed, |
| * so it assumes [vaddr_start, len) fully maps to after-split folios within that |
| * range. |
| * |
| * Return: 0 - no error, -1 - unhandled cases |
| */ |
| static int gather_after_split_folio_orders(char *vaddr_start, size_t len, |
| int pagemap_fd, int kpageflags_fd, int orders[], int nr_orders) |
| { |
| uint64_t page_flags = 0; |
| int cur_order = -1; |
| char *vaddr; |
| |
| if (pagemap_fd == -1 || kpageflags_fd == -1) |
| return -1; |
| if (!orders) |
| return -1; |
| if (nr_orders <= 0) |
| return -1; |
| |
| for (vaddr = vaddr_start; vaddr < vaddr_start + len;) { |
| char *next_folio_vaddr; |
| int status; |
| |
| status = vaddr_pageflags_get(vaddr, pagemap_fd, kpageflags_fd, |
| &page_flags); |
| if (status < 0) |
| return -1; |
| |
| /* skip non present vaddr */ |
| if (status == 1) { |
| vaddr += psize(); |
| continue; |
| } |
| |
| /* all order-0 pages with possible false postive (non folio) */ |
| if (!(page_flags & (KPF_COMPOUND_HEAD | KPF_COMPOUND_TAIL))) { |
| orders[0]++; |
| vaddr += psize(); |
| continue; |
| } |
| |
| /* skip non thp compound pages */ |
| if (!(page_flags & KPF_THP)) { |
| vaddr += psize(); |
| continue; |
| } |
| |
| /* vpn points to part of a THP at this point */ |
| if (page_flags & KPF_COMPOUND_HEAD) |
| cur_order = 1; |
| else { |
| vaddr += psize(); |
| continue; |
| } |
| |
| next_folio_vaddr = vaddr + (1UL << (cur_order + pshift())); |
| |
| if (next_folio_vaddr >= vaddr_start + len) |
| break; |
| |
| while ((status = vaddr_pageflags_get(next_folio_vaddr, |
| pagemap_fd, kpageflags_fd, |
| &page_flags)) >= 0) { |
| /* |
| * non present vaddr, next compound head page, or |
| * order-0 page |
| */ |
| if (status == 1 || |
| (page_flags & KPF_COMPOUND_HEAD) || |
| !(page_flags & (KPF_COMPOUND_HEAD | KPF_COMPOUND_TAIL))) { |
| if (cur_order < nr_orders) { |
| orders[cur_order]++; |
| cur_order = -1; |
| vaddr = next_folio_vaddr; |
| } |
| break; |
| } |
| |
| cur_order++; |
| next_folio_vaddr = vaddr + (1UL << (cur_order + pshift())); |
| } |
| |
| if (status < 0) |
| return status; |
| } |
| if (cur_order > 0 && cur_order < nr_orders) |
| orders[cur_order]++; |
| return 0; |
| } |

| static void split_pte_mapped_thp(void) |
| { |
| const size_t nr_thps = 4; |
| const size_t thp_area_size = nr_thps * pmd_pagesize; |
| const size_t page_area_size = nr_thps * pagesize; |
| char *thp_area, *tmp, *page_area = MAP_FAILED; |
| size_t i; |
| |
| thp_area = mmap((void *)(1UL << 30), thp_area_size, PROT_READ | PROT_WRITE, |
| MAP_ANONYMOUS | MAP_PRIVATE, -1, 0); |
| if (thp_area == MAP_FAILED) { |
| ksft_test_result_fail("Fail to allocate memory: %s\n", strerror(errno)); |
| return; |
| } |
| |
| madvise(thp_area, thp_area_size, MADV_HUGEPAGE); |
| |
| for (i = 0; i < thp_area_size; i++) |
| thp_area[i] = (char)i; |
| |
| if (!check_huge_anon(thp_area, nr_thps, pmd_pagesize)) { |
| ksft_test_result_skip("Not all THPs allocated\n"); |
| goto out; |
| } |
| |
| /* |
| * To challenge spitting code, we will mremap a single page of each |
| * THP (page[i] of thp[i]) in the thp_area into page_area. This will |
| * replace the PMD mappings in the thp_area by PTE mappings first, |
| * but leaving the THP unsplit, to then create a page-sized hole in |
| * the thp_area. |
| * We will then manually trigger splitting of all THPs through the |
| * single mremap'ed pages of each THP in the page_area. |
| */ |
| page_area = mmap(NULL, page_area_size, PROT_READ | PROT_WRITE, |
| MAP_ANONYMOUS | MAP_PRIVATE, -1, 0); |
| if (page_area == MAP_FAILED) { |
| ksft_test_result_fail("Fail to allocate memory: %s\n", strerror(errno)); |
| goto out; |
| } |
| |
| for (i = 0; i < nr_thps; i++) { |
| tmp = mremap(thp_area + pmd_pagesize * i + pagesize * i, |
| pagesize, pagesize, MREMAP_MAYMOVE|MREMAP_FIXED, |
| page_area + pagesize * i); |
| if (tmp != MAP_FAILED) |
| continue; |
| ksft_test_result_fail("mremap failed: %s\n", strerror(errno)); |
| goto out; |
| } |
| |
| /* |
| * Verify that our THPs were not split yet. Note that |
| * check_huge_anon() cannot be used as it checks for PMD mappings. |
| */ |
| for (i = 0; i < nr_thps; i++) { |
| if (is_backed_by_folio(page_area + i * pagesize, pmd_order, |
| pagemap_fd, kpageflags_fd)) |
| continue; |
| ksft_test_result_fail("THP %zu missing after mremap\n", i); |
| goto out; |
| } |
| |
| /* Split all THPs through the remapped pages. */ |
| write_debugfs(PID_FMT, getpid(), (uint64_t)page_area, |
| (uint64_t)page_area + page_area_size, 0); |
| |
| /* Corruption during mremap or split? */ |
| for (i = 0; i < page_area_size; i++) { |
| if (page_area[i] == (char)i) |
| continue; |
| ksft_test_result_fail("%zu byte corrupted\n", i); |
| goto out; |
| } |
| |
| /* Split failed? */ |
| for (i = 0; i < nr_thps; i++) { |
| if (is_backed_by_folio(page_area + i * pagesize, 0, |
| pagemap_fd, kpageflags_fd)) |
| continue; |
| ksft_test_result_fail("THP %zu not split\n", i); |
| } |
| |
| ksft_test_result_pass("Split PTE-mapped huge pages successful\n"); |
| out: |
| munmap(thp_area, thp_area_size); |
| if (page_area != MAP_FAILED) |
| munmap(page_area, page_area_size); |
| } |
